Preparation
Preparation Instructions
1. Combine Ingredients
In a cocktail shaker, combine the pisco, agave syrup, fresh lemon juice, and egg whites.
2. Dry Shake
Shake the mixture vigorously without ice (this is called a dry shake) for about 15 seconds to emulsify the egg whites.
3. Add Ice and Shake Again
Add ice to the shaker and shake again for another 15-20 seconds until well chilled.
4. Strain and Serve
Strain the mixture into a chilled coupe or cocktail glass.
5. Add Bitters
Add 2 dashes of Angostura bitters on top of the foam created by the egg whites.
6. Garnish (optional)
Garnish with a lemon twist or a dash of additional bitters if desired.
